How long does it take to fly to Orlando?

Flight times vary depending on what airport in Australia you fly out of and what airport in Orlando you fly into. For example, flying from Brisbane to Orlando Airport takes 21h 39m on average. On the other hand, flying from Sydney to Orlando Airport takes 23h 23m on average. Keep in mind that it’s always quicker to opt for a non-stop flight, so be sure to check momondo to see if there are any available for your route.

Is it worth flying First Class to Orlando?

While the experience can vary from airline to airline, First Class flights are one of the most luxurious flying experiences available. Some airlines can offer premium lounge access, while others may have exclusive in-flight perks aside from the extra legroom. How old do you have to be to fly from Australia to Orlando?

The minimum age for a child to fly alone is five, but airlines offering an unaccompanied minor (UNMR) service may have their age restrictions, such as regulations concerning flight duration, timing, and stopovers. It is recommended that you verify with the airline you are booking with for travel from Australia to Orlando.

What documentation or ID do you need to fly to Orlando?

The necessary travel and health documents for your Orlando trip may vary depending on your travel plans and individual circumstances. Generally, you should have various documents, such as a national ID card or driver's licence and a passport that is valid for six months beyond your scheduled arrival date. We recommend seeking advice from your airline or a trusted third party, such as IATA.
